package com.kidgrow.common.utils;
 
import com.google.zxing.BarcodeFormat;
import com.google.zxing.EncodeHintType;
import com.google.zxing.MultiFormatWriter;
import com.google.zxing.WriterException;
import com.google.zxing.common.BitMatrix;
import com.google.zxing.qrcode.decoder.ErrorCorrectionLevel;
import sun.misc.BASE64Encoder;
 
import javax.imageio.ImageIO;
import java.awt.image.BufferedImage;
import java.io.ByteArrayOutputStream;
import java.io.IOException;
import java.util.Hashtable;
 
import static com.google.zxing.client.j2se.MatrixToImageConfig.BLACK;
import static com.google.zxing.client.j2se.MatrixToImageConfig.WHITE;
 
/**
 * @Author: dougang
 * @Description:
 * @Date: create in 2020/6/19 10:02
 */
public class QRCodeUtil {
 
    /**
     * 生成二维码
     *
     * @param contents
     * @param width
     * @param height
     * @param level    0:M,1:L,2:H,3:Q
     * @return
     */
    public static String creatRrCode(String contents, int width, int height, int level) {
        String binary = null;
        Hashtable hints = new Hashtable();
        hints.put(EncodeHintType.CHARACTER_SET, "utf-8");
        switch (level) {
            case 0:
                hints.put(EncodeHintType.ERROR_CORRECTION, ErrorCorrectionLevel.M);
                break;
            case 1:
                hints.put(EncodeHintType.ERROR_CORRECTION, ErrorCorrectionLevel.L);
                break;
            case 2:
                hints.put(EncodeHintType.ERROR_CORRECTION, ErrorCorrectionLevel.H);
                break;
            case 3:
                hints.put(EncodeHintType.ERROR_CORRECTION, ErrorCorrectionLevel.Q);
                break;
            default:
                break;
        }
 
        try {
            BitMatrix bitMatrix = new MultiFormatWriter().encode(
                    contents, BarcodeFormat.QR_CODE, width, height, hints);
            // 读取文件转换为字节数组
            ByteArrayOutputStream out = new ByteArrayOutputStream();
 
            BufferedImage image = toBufferedImage(bitMatrix);
            //切白边
            image = deleteWhite(bitMatrix);
 
            //转换成png格式的IO流
            ImageIO.write(image, "png", out);
            byte[] bytes = out.toByteArray();
 
            // 将字节数组转为二进制
            BASE64Encoder encoder = new BASE64Encoder();
            binary = "data:image/png;base64," + encoder.encodeBuffer(bytes).trim();
        } catch (WriterException e) {
            // TODO Auto-generated catch block
            e.printStackTrace();
        } catch (IOException e) {
            // TODO Auto-generated catch block
            e.printStackTrace();
        }
        return binary;
    }
 
    /**
     * image流数据处理
     *
     * @author ianly
     */
    private static BufferedImage toBufferedImage(BitMatrix matrix) {
        int width = matrix.getWidth();
        int height = matrix.getHeight();
        BufferedImage image = new BufferedImage(width, height, BufferedImage.TYPE_INT_RGB);
        for (int x = 0; x < width; x++) {
            for (int y = 0; y < height; y++) {
                image.setRGB(x, y, matrix.get(x, y) ? 0xFF000000 : 0xFFFFFFFF);
            }
        }
 
        return image;
    }
 
    /**
     * 切白边
     *
     * @param matrix
     * @return
     */
    private static BufferedImage deleteWhite(BitMatrix matrix) {
        int[] rec = matrix.getEnclosingRectangle();
        int resWidth = rec[2] + 1;
        int resHeight = rec[3] + 1;
 
        BitMatrix resMatrix = new BitMatrix(resWidth, resHeight);
        resMatrix.clear();
        for (int i = 0; i < resWidth; i++) {
            for (int j = 0; j < resHeight; j++) {
                if (matrix.get(i + rec[0], j + rec[1]))
                    resMatrix.set(i, j);
            }
        }
 
        int width = resMatrix.getWidth();
        int height = resMatrix.getHeight();
        BufferedImage image = new BufferedImage(width, height,
                BufferedImage.TYPE_INT_RGB);
        for (int x = 0; x < width; x++) {
            for (int y = 0; y < height; y++) {
                image.setRGB(x, y, resMatrix.get(x, y) ? BLACK : WHITE);
            }
        }
        return image;
    }
